A Harlem man was arrested in August for allegedly abandoning his two dogs in his apartment � where one apparently ate the other. Rodney McNeil had been sought after neighbors complained about a stench coming from his East 135th Street apartment.
Inside, police found a dead pit bull and a barely alive Rottweiler.
When McNeil, 43, showed up in Bronx Criminal Court to plead guilty to marijuana possession, the ASPCA arrested him on two charges of animal cruelty. McNeil allegedly left his apartment and moved into a homeless shelter. Neighborhood MapFor more information about the Interactive Animal Cruelty Maps, see the map notes.
